Overview of Performance

For the fiscal year ending March 2026, consolidated results showed net sales of ¥349.407 billion (up 1.9% YoY) and operating income of ¥37.017 billion (up 23.5% YoY), achieving both higher sales and profits. Ordinary income rose significantly to ¥38.23 billion (up 29.1% YoY), however, net income attributable to owners of parent decreased to ¥22.25 billion (down 5.1% YoY). The increase in sales was driven by newly consolidated Tokuyama Life Science Group and increased sales of semiconductor-related products. Improvement in manufacturing costs contributed to the rise in operating income. By segment, electronic advanced materials, cement, life sciences, and environmental businesses posted profit growth, whereas the chemical products segment experienced a profit decline.

Capital Policy and Dividends

The year-end dividend was set at ¥60 per share, resulting in an annual dividend of ¥120 including the interim dividend of ¥60, a ¥20 increase from the previous fiscal year. The dividend payout ratio is 38.9%. The dividend forecast for the fiscal year ending March 2027 remains undecided and will be determined based on performance trends. The number of shares outstanding remains unchanged at 72,088,327 shares. The equity ratio declined by 4.1 points to 50.8% from the previous year but the financial structure remains stable.

Business Portfolio Transformation and M&A

Based on the priority tasks of the Medium-Term Management Plan 2025, investments have been strengthened in growth areas such as 'Electronics,' 'Healthcare,' and 'Environment.' We acquired the in vitro diagnostic pharmaceuticals business from JSR Corporation and newly consolidated the Tokuyama Life Science Group. We withdrew from unprofitable operations in China and are restructuring the cement business. These actions accelerate strengthening competitiveness and reallocating resources to growth businesses.

Financial Position and Cash Flows

Total assets increased 17.1% YoY to ¥557.432 billion, liabilities rose 28.3% YoY to ¥259.620 billion, and net assets grew 8.7% YoY to ¥297.811 billion. Due to the increase in interest-bearing debt, the debt-to-equity ratio deteriorated to 0.57 times. Cash flows from operating activities were stable at ¥50.985 billion, cash flows from investing activities significantly increased with expenditures of ¥122.975 billion, and cash flows from financing activities resulted in inflows of ¥41.792 billion.

Outlook

The consolidated earnings forecast for the fiscal year ending March 2027 remains undecided, due to heightened risks from uncertain procurement of raw materials and fuel as well as rising costs. Once a reasonable earnings forecast is feasible, it will be promptly announced. The company will continue to focus on growth areas to enhance corporate value.
